Girls’ Generations’ Yoona nominated at 2018 Asian Film Awards for ‘Confidential Assignment’ role
Professionally known as Yoona, Im Yoon-ah
received several accolades for her “Confidential Assignment” role, the most
recent of which is a 2018 Asian Film Awards nomination. The member of the K-pop
girl group Girls’ Generation was nominated as Best Newcomer in the 12th
edition of the annual awards ceremony.
For her role as Park Min-young in “Confidential
Assignment,” Yoona won the Popularity Award in the actress category in the
inaugural The Seoul Awards. She also won Best Popular Asian Actress in the
inaugural Marianas International Film Festival.
For the same role, Yoon won the Newcomer Award
at the third Korean Film Shining Star Awards, the Rising Star Award at the 22nd
Busan International Film Festival and the Most Popular Actress Award under the
film category of the 53rd Baeksang Arts Awards. She was also
nominated as Best New Actress at the 38th Blue Dragon Film Awards
but lost to “Anarchist from Colony” actress Choi Hee-seo.
For the Best Newcomer category at the 2018
Asian Film Awards, Yoona will compete with five other actresses. They are “Youth” actress Zhong
Chuxi and “Angels Wear White” actress Zhou Meijun, both from China, as well as “Tomorrow
is Another Day” actress Ling Man-lung from Hong Kong, Akari Kinoshita from Japan
and “Bad Genius” Chutimon Chuengcharoensukying from Thailand.
The 12th Asian Film Awards ceremony
will take place on March 17, 2018 at The Venetian Macao in Macau. It has yet to be confirmed if
Yoona is attending the ceremony.
Among Yoona’s “Confidential Assignment” co-stars
are Hyun Bin, Kim Joo-hyuk, Yoo Hae-jin, Park Min-ha, Lee Dong-hwi and Jang
